What does a lead generation and Facebook lead generation setup need before launch for professional services?
You need a clear Facebook offer, defined campaign audience, lead form or landing page path, qualification rules, and a fast response process once inquiries arrive. For professional service firms, we also review service fit, location fit, timing, lead ownership, and whether the team can handle new Facebook leads quickly enough to protect buyer intent.
How is Lead Generation performance measured for professional services?
We measure Facebook lead generation from campaign source to consultations, discovery calls, and qualified first conversations, not only cost per lead. Useful metrics include lead form completion quality, qualified lead rate, response time, booking rate, campaign and ad set quality, CRM stage movement, and sales feedback from the team handling the opportunities.

What should the handoff look like after a professional services lead converts?
The handoff should show who owns the lead, what the buyer asked for, which source created the inquiry, what qualification details were collected, and what the next step is. For professional service firms, that visibility keeps the lead from sitting in an inbox or moving to sales without enough context.
